Rsu 18 School District Details

Rsu 18 School District
41 Heath Street
Oakland, ME 04963

2,714 Students enrolled in District

8 Schools in District

14 Students Per Classroom (State average is 11)

School District Enrollment by Group

Ethnic/racial Groups This District This State
White (non-hispanic) 96.4% 90.6%
Black 0.8% 4.3%
Hispanic 2.2% 2.8%
Asian Or Pacific Islander 0.4% 1.5%
American Indian Or Native Of Alaska 0.3% 0.9%
Economic Groups This District This State
ECONOMICALLY DISADVANTAGED 31.4% 39.4%
FREE LUNCH ELIGIBLE 25.4% 33.5%
REDUCED LUNCH ELIGIBLE 6.0% 5.9%

Educational Expenditures

For This District Per Student Total % Of Total
Instructional Expenditures $7,889 $20,740,181 50.9%
Support Expenditures
Student $1,065 $2,799,885 6.9%
Staff $1,111 $2,920,819 7.2%
General Administration $347 $912,263 2.2%
School Administration $797 $2,095,313 5.1%
Operation $1,555 $4,088,095 10.0%
Transportation $835 $2,195,215 5.4%
Other $165 $433,785 1.1%
Total Support $5,876 $15,448,004 37.9%
Non-instructional Expenditures $1,746 $4,590,234 11.3%
Total Expenditures $15,511 $40,778,419 100.0%
